The only thing I'd like to add is that a look at the active chapter roll on Kappa Kappa Gamma's web site might suggest that a new Kappa chapter at a school in the California State University system would be unusual. Of the KKG collegiate chapters in California, only two are at CSU schools:
CSU - Fresno (established around 1954, I believe) and CSU - Northridge (established around 1974). All the other Kappa chapters appear to be either at branches of the University of California (Berkeley, UCLA, Davis, Irvine, UC - San Diego, Santa Barbara, and Riverside) or at private schools (Stanford, USC, Pepperdine, and the University of San Diego). Even if the Greek system at CSULB were stronger, I wonder if it would be considered a good fit for that particular sorority.
